Common Interface

To receive scrambled D.TV channels you will
need a CA module and smart card provided
by your service provider.
Different CA modules support different
encryption systems. This recorder is
designed to work with modules that support
the DVB standard. Contact your service
provider to obtain the right kind of CA
module.
Note that neither CA modules nor smart
cards are supplied or sold by Pioneer.
Inserting a CA module
The Common Interface card slot is located
on the rear panel of the recorder.
